Office Depot Trade-In Process
Office Depot partners with third-party vendors to evaluate and buy used electronics. The process typically involves:
- Visiting an Office Depot store or their website
- Providing details about your phone model and condition
- Receiving an estimated trade-in value
- Bringing your device to the store or mailing it in for assessment
- Receiving store credit or a gift card upon approval
One advantage of Office Depot is the convenience of in-store assessments and immediate store credit, which can be used for purchases right away.
Apple Trade-In Process
Apple offers a dedicated trade-in program, both online and in-store. The steps include:
- Using the Apple Trade-In website or visiting an Apple Store
- Answering questions about your device’s condition and model
- Receiving an instant quote or shipping label for mailing your device
- Sending your phone to Apple for evaluation
- Receiving Apple Store credit or a gift card if eligible
Apple’s program often provides higher trade-in values for newer models and offers seamless integration with purchasing new devices or accessories.
Comparison of Benefits
When comparing Office Depot and Apple trade-in options, consider the following:
- Value: Apple generally offers higher trade-in values, especially for newer models.
- Convenience: Office Depot provides quick in-store assessments, while Apple offers online options and mail-in services.
- Rewards: Both programs offer store credit, but Apple’s credit is more directly applicable to Apple products.
- Environmental Impact: Both programs promote recycling and responsible disposal.
Which Option Is Better?
The choice depends on your priorities. If you want the highest possible trade-in value and are comfortable mailing your device, Apple’s program may be the better option. For quick, in-store evaluations and immediate store credit, Office Depot is convenient and straightforward.
Tips for a Successful Trade-In
To maximize your trade-in value, follow these tips:
- Back up your data and erase personal information
- Ensure your device is clean and free of damage
- Gather accessories like chargers and cables
- Compare trade-in estimates from both programs
- Choose the option that offers the best value and convenience
